How do I get rid of terra incognita?

How do I get rid of terra incognita?

You need a conquistador and land on them or keep sailing nearby with an explorer. It can take a long time with an explorer but if you sail in and out of the map tile or in a path through many map tiles with islands eventually you will clear the terra incognita.

How do you get an explorer in Europa Universalis 4?

In order to explore past terra incognita you need an army or navy that’s lead by a conquistador or explorer, respectively. You can hire these leaders with the regular generals/admirals in the Military tab, and you can assign them to an army/navy when you select the unit in friendly territory.

Who gave the concept of terra incognita?

Terra incognita or terra ignota (Latin “unknown land”; incognita is stressed on its second syllable in Latin, but with variation in pronunciation in English) is a term used in cartography for regions that have not been mapped or documented. The expression is believed to be first seen in Ptolemy’s Geography c. 150.
